Join us for an evening in the library as we listen to some live and local music. It is sort of like Tiny Desk, but just in the library :) Out of North Carolina, Leffty is an American band founded by drummer Joshua Davell Scott and vocalist Kingsley Priester. Blending modern alternative, R&B, and soul, the band creates a sound that feels atmospheric, intimate, and emotionally raw. Drawing inspiration from artists like Coldplay, The 1975, and Frank Ocean, Leffty lives in the space between vulnerability, groove, and introspection. The name Leffty comes from the idea of embracing what makes you different. Like being left-handed - uncommon and sometimes misunderstood - the band believes that uniqueness isn't something to hide, but something to lean into. Through each song, Leffty explores emotions that are often suppressed and stories that often go unspoken. Their music creates space for listeners to reconnect with themselves, sit with honesty, and ultimately feel again.
